1 Samuel 17: 38 – 39 (NLT): “Then Saul gave David his own armor—a bronze helmet and a coat of mail. David put it on, strapped the sword over it, and took a step or two to see what it was like, for he had never worn such things before. ‘I can’t go in these,’ he protested to Saul. ‘I’m not used to them.’  So David took them off again.”

 

 

Hear this today; God desires for you to thrive in your calling! What He has placed inside you, and the path He has set out for you to walk in, has been designed and purposed to cause you to thrive and flourish! However, something that will quickly hinder your calling is comparison. Comparison breeds doubt, frustration, and the feeling of inadequacy. God has set before us a wonderful plan that is unique and specific to each of us. When David got ready to defeat Goliath, he was offered the armour of King Saul.  He soon realised it didn’t fit and would only weigh and slow him down. He wouldn’t be able to defeat Goliath wearing someone else’s armour. Instead, he took it off and placed his full confidence in Who he personally knew the Lord to be. David faced the giant wearing what God had already given Him, the anointing and strategy he was already familiar with to bring this enemy down. If you live a life comparing your calling to the way others do ministry, you will never have the confidence and ability to overcome the challenges along the way.  As you draw near to the Lord, and learn directly from Him, you will be fully equipped to stand confidently against any enemy you face. Only do what God has called you to do. He will give you the boldness and power to fulfil your call with great success and a maturity to confidently know your identity in Him as He leads you on the path of goodness, purpose and blessing.
